Ghs Pf120 Stainless Steel 6 String Banjo Strings These Ghs Loop End Banjo Strings Are Extra Long (42'' Winding) To Fit Any Banjo. Specially Designed Loop Ends To Fit A Variety Of Tailpieces. Plain Strings With Ghs Lock Twist To Stay In Tune. Light Gauge 011 014 018 024W 034W 042W %%Panel.Whybuyfromus%%.
